Comprehensive Service Overview

Electrical repair work in Damascus typically addresses a range of common household issues. Tripping breakers, dead outlets, switches that have stopped working, and lighting that flickers or dims unexpectedly are among the most frequent concerns homeowners run into.

For older homes in and around downtown Damascus, wiring repairs often focus on bringing outdated systems up to a safer standard. Many of these homes were built before modern appliances and electronics were common, and their original wiring may not handle today’s loads comfortably. Repairs in these situations frequently involve replacing worn-out wiring, upgrading panels, or adding dedicated circuits for heavier-use areas like kitchens and home workshops.

In newer developments along the town’s outskirts, electrical concerns tend to center more on individual circuit issues, ground fault protection for outdoor and garage outlets, and problems that arise from normal usage or occasional storm-related impacts.

A well-handled electrical repair begins with accurately pinpointing the cause rather than just treating the symptom. Understanding whether a tripping breaker is due to an overloaded circuit, a faulty appliance, or a compromised wire makes all the difference. A thorough assessment—rather than just resetting the breaker or swapping an outlet—addresses the root of the problem.

Every repair in Damascus also benefits from consideration of local weather conditions. Outdoor outlets, lighting for porches or trails, and electrical connections in outbuildings all need proper protection against moisture, especially given the region’s humid summers and freeze-thaw winter cycles. For homeowners, knowing what’s behind the issue and what the solution involves brings reassurance that the work is done thoughtfully.

Why Choose a Local Pro?

There are good reasons for Damascus homeowners to work with someone familiar with the local area. The mix of older and newer housing means electrical systems can vary significantly from one street to the next—a house built in the 1940s downtown may have completely different wiring considerations than a home built in the 2000s on the outskirts.

Licensing matters in Virginia. Electrical work in Damascus requires adherence to the National Electrical Code along with applicable state and local amendments. A properly licensed technician brings the assurance that any repairs will meet those standards—something that becomes especially important when selling a home or documenting work.

Beyond licensing, familiarity with Damascus's housing stock, weather patterns, and common problem areas means fewer surprises during a repair. Whether it’s knowing which older neighborhoods are likely to have original wiring or understanding how seasonal weather affects outdoor connections, local knowledge of Washington County translates into a more straightforward process for homeowners.

Regional Characteristics

Damascus sits in a mountain valley at roughly 1,900 feet elevation, with the South Fork of the Holston River and Laurel Creek running through town. The housing stock includes a notable number of older homes dating to the early and mid-20th century, particularly around the downtown core, alongside newer residential developments on the outskirts. Winters bring cold temperatures and occasional snow, while summers are warm with regular thunderstorms—weather patterns that can affect outdoor electrical components and aging wiring. The area’s rural and small-town character means homes are often set on larger lots, with detached garages, workshops, and outdoor structures that have their own electrical needs.

Common Issues

The most common electrical concerns Damascus homeowners encounter include frequent breaker trips, outlets or switches that have stopped working, flickering or dimming lights (especially when appliances kick on), and older wiring systems not designed for today’s electrical loads. Outdoor outlets and fixtures can also be affected by moisture and seasonal weather, leading to corrosion or ground fault issues. In older homes in and around downtown, two-prong ungrounded outlets and outdated panel systems are also a frequent consideration.
